Crystal Palace reserves have been crowned champions of the reserve league following a 3-0 win away to Luton Town.
Steve Kember's side got off to a flyer as Tommy Black fired in a free-kick from 25 yards which went into the top left corner, in off the crossbar.
Luton got back into the game and dominated proceedings and halfway through the second period scored twice in two minutes to seal the match.
Gavin Heeroo got the second goal in the 73rd minute, slotting home when put through with a one-on-one with the keeper.
Moments later, substitute Ben Surey's volley was spectactularly saved by the keeper but only as far as Dougie Freedman who headed in from a yard out.
The victory means Palace cannot be caught at the top of the Avon Insurance Combination League and are worthy championship winners.
